Navigating The Digital World: The Importance Of Multimedia Literacy

In today’s fast-paced and technology-driven society, the ability to navigate and critically analyze multimedia content is more important than ever. This skill, known as multimedia literacy, is essential for individuals to effectively interact with the vast array of digital media that surrounds them on a daily basis.

multimedia literacy encompasses a wide range of abilities, including the skills to access, analyze, evaluate, and create multimedia content. It goes beyond traditional literacy skills, such as reading and writing, and encompasses the ability to interpret and understand multimedia messages in various forms, including video, audio, images, and interactive media. With the rise of social media, online news outlets, and streaming services, the need for multimedia literacy has become increasingly apparent.

One of the key aspects of multimedia literacy is the ability to critically analyze and evaluate the information presented in multimedia content. In today’s digital age, it is easy for anyone to create and distribute multimedia content, which can make it difficult to determine the accuracy and credibility of the information being presented. Individuals with strong multimedia literacy skills can effectively discern between reliable sources and biased or inaccurate information, helping them make informed decisions and form well-rounded opinions.
